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Ayr to Southend Central start from as little as £45.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ayr to Southend Central start from £104.60 one way, or £194.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ayr to Southend Central are available for £133.30 one way, or £431.00 return

Ayr Station Facilities

Ayr Train Station is well-equipped to meet the needs of all travelers. The ticket office operates from the early hours of 5:30 AM until late at night at 11:15 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while Sundays offer slightly adjusted times. For your convenience, there are ticket machines available for easy purchase and collection, including accessible machines. The station also offers step-free access to most platforms, making it accessible for those with mobility challenges. However, please note that there are no toilets or refreshment facilities available on-site.

You'll find help points and an induction loop throughout the station, emphasizing customer support and inclusivity. If you need assistance, knowledgeable staff are available from early morning to midnight most days of the week, eager to provide any information or support you may require.

Facilities and Amenities

At Southend Central, purchasing tickets is a breeze with a ticket office open Monday through Sunday and accessible ticket machines available for those on the move. Smartcard validators are on site, though smartcards aren't issued at the station, ensuring ease of access for all travelers. For any questions or concerns, the staff at the ticket office is ready to assist during broad hours throughout the week.

Accessibility is taken seriously at Southend Central. There are induction loops for the hard of hearing, ramps for train access, and CCTV for safety. While there is no waiting room, seating areas are dotted around the station. Accessible toilets are available on Platforms 3 and 4, along with baby-changing facilities.

Travel Connections

Southend Central is well-connected with varied onward travel options. If your journey requires a bus, catch the rail replacement services at Clifftown Road near The Last Public House. For air travel, Southend Airport is just a train ride away from nearby Southend Victoria station. While accessible taxis are not directly available at the station, you can find taxis in the nearby town centre, ensuring a smooth transition from rail to road.
